Treasury bills vs CDs: the highest advertised rate is not the whole comparison

Searches for Treasury bills rates today and CD rates today usually begin with one number: yield. A useful comparison goes further. Treasury bills and certificates of deposit differ in tax treatment, liquidity, insurance structure, purchase process, early-exit cost, and what happens when the investment matures.

How Treasury bills work

Treasury bills are short-term U.S. government securities with maturities of one year or less. They are generally sold at a discount or at par, with the investor receiving the face value at maturity. TreasuryDirect explains the auction and maturity structure on its Treasury bills page.

Treasury interest is subject to federal income tax but is generally exempt from state and local income taxes. That can improve the after-tax comparison for residents of states with income tax.

Bills can be purchased through TreasuryDirect or a brokerage. A brokerage may make secondary-market selling easier, but the market price can move before maturity.

How CDs work

A CD is a time deposit issued by a bank or credit union. The institution promises an interest rate for a stated term. Traditional CDs may charge an early-withdrawal penalty; brokered CDs can trade at gains or losses before maturity.

Deposit insurance is a key distinction. Eligible bank deposits are covered by FDIC insurance within applicable ownership categories and limits. Readers should verify the institution and coverage using official FDIC deposit insurance resources. Credit unions may use NCUA coverage instead.

CD interest is generally subject to federal and state income tax. The tax timing and reporting can vary by product, so this page does not provide tax advice.

Compare after-tax yield

Suppose a Treasury bill and CD have similar headline yields. The Treasury’s state-tax treatment may give it a higher after-tax return for some investors. But a CD could still be preferable if it offers a clearly higher rate, simpler banking access, or a maturity that better matches the goal.

Liquidity and early exit

A short-term investment should match the date the money may be needed. Selling a Treasury before maturity introduces market-price risk. Breaking a traditional CD may trigger a penalty. Selling a brokered CD may produce a loss if rates rose after purchase.

An emergency fund should prioritize reliable access. Money for a known expense can be matched to a maturity date. A ladder can divide money across several maturities so everything does not renew at once.

Reinvestment risk

A high short-term yield may not last. When the bill or CD matures, the next available rate could be lower. That is reinvestment risk. Longer maturities can lock a rate for more time but reduce flexibility and may increase price sensitivity if sold early.

Bottom line

Treasury bills versus CDs is not a universal winner question. Compare after-tax yield, access, maturity, insurance or government backing, early-exit rules, and reinvestment risk.
